Preferred Label : Hemosiderotic Plaque;

NCIt related terms : Fibrosiderosis;

NCIt definition : Yellow-brown, small, and firm nodules composed of fibrous tissue and collagenous and/or elastic fibers that are impregnated with bilirubin, hemosiderin, and/or calcium salts.;
